Gatekeepers News reports that UNESCO is the United Nations Educational, Scientific and Cultural Organization. It seeks to build peace through international cooperation in Education, the Sciences and Culture. UNESCO’s programmes contribute to the achievement of the Sustainable Development Goals defined in Agenda 2030, adopted by the UN General Assembly in 2015.

- The international community has set an ambitious 2030 Agenda for Sustainable Development. It calls for an integrated approach to development. Education and training are central to the achievement of the 2030 Agenda.
- The vision of the Incheon Declaration about Education 2030 is fully captured by Sustainable Development Goal 4 “Ensure inclusive and equitable quality education and promote lifelong learning opportunities for all”. Education 2030 devotes considerable attention to technical and vocational skills development, specifically regarding access to affordable quality Technical and Vocational Education and Training (TVET); acquisition of technical and vocational skills for employment, decent work and entrepreneurship; elimination of gender disparity and ensuring access for the vulnerable – see also SDG 8 “Promote inclusive and sustainable economic growth, employment and decent work for all”.
- Under the overall authority of the Director of the UNESCO Multisectoral Regional Office for West Africa (in Abuja, Nigeria) and the direct supervision of the Senior Programme Specialist, the incumbent will act as the focal point for the overall coordination of the BEAR III project and technical backstopping of TVET, which will also focus on coordination and building partnerships for scaling up of TVET interventions.
